I have the Elite 56txi, and I have kept my mains at large even though I have a sub. In fact, since my center and surrounds can supply excellent base, I have them all set as large, and just use the subwoofer at 60Hz and below to help fill in the low range. To do this on my receiver, my sub is set to the "plus" setting in the Speaker setup. I think it sounds great. I'm not sure how well the Klipsch mains handle bass, but if they do a decent job, I see no reason to set them to small.

As for the second question, turning up the channel levels on your speakers should not hurt sound quallity. If doing so introduces brightness, then that is probably just magnifying weaknesses in your speakers. As long as you keep the channel levels balanced, then turning them up should not hurt surround effects either.
